** The Lexus repair market directly serving Hoolehua, Hawaii, is effectively non-existent due to the town's small size and rural nature. The broader market for Molokai residents is regional, requiring reliance on service providers on Maui and Oahu. For routine maintenance, residents may use general mechanics on Molokai, but for the specialized services requested (hybrid systems, AWD, air suspension), inter-island service is the standard and expected solution. **Competition Level:** While there is no local competition in Hoolehua, the options on Maui and Oahu are highly competitive and of excellent quality. Both dealerships maintain a reputation for OEM-standard service, while independents like LexTech offer specialized expertise.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is at a premium due to Hawaii's cost of living and the specialized nature of the work. Dealership labor rates are typically in the $180-$220/hour range, while top independents are slightly lower at $150-$180/hour. Consumers must also factor in the significant cost of inter-island vehicle shipping (several hundred dollars round-trip), which is a fundamental part of the cost structure for major repairs in this unique geographic context.
